Otis Taylor

Otis Taylor

  • Birthday: 1948-07-30
  • Place of birth: Chicago, Illinois, USA

Biography

Find all Otis Taylor Movies on AZ movies.

Filmography

Crossroads

1986

As Jookhouse Musician - Lead Guitar

Production

La Dernière Caravane

2012

As Music

keyboard_arrow_up